Граф коммитов

5383 Коммитов

Автор SHA1 Сообщение Дата
sharparrow1%yahoo.com 0859cc57d2 Bug 382458, additional patch to fix repainting problems with theming and pixel rounding. r=vlad, a=blocking1.9+ 2007-08-17 20:30:23 +00:00
vladimir%pobox.com e7ae74d226 b=391583, DoesARGBImageDataHaveAlpha is slow, r=stuart,a=me 2007-08-17 19:55:00 +00:00
ginn.chen%sun.com 3e6dc55d45 Bug 391184 Firefox crashed [@ _get_bitmap_surface] div zero in _cairo_malloc_ab macro
r+a=vladimir
2007-08-16 03:53:19 +00:00
mats.palmgren%bredband.net 80b7a111ef Backing out last change since it caused crashes on Windows (bug 392214). b=390898 2007-08-14 19:03:57 +00:00
masayuki%d-toybox.com 65dfc1fb74 Bug 365414 overflowed decoration lines are not erased/painted r+sr=roc 2007-08-14 16:39:55 +00:00
mats.palmgren%bredband.net 9feeb0b0c4 Bustage fix. b=391243 2007-08-14 11:46:26 +00:00
mats.palmgren%bredband.net 31dc6709ea Bandaid for a Cairo crash. b=390898 r+sr=vladimir 2007-08-14 09:48:49 +00:00
mats.palmgren%bredband.net f7d6a8381f Don't crash when CurrentSurface() or GetDC() return null. b=391243 r+sr+a=vladimir 2007-08-14 09:47:37 +00:00
joshmoz%gmail.com df19edac52 Fix font size for submit and file input buttons. b=262191 sr=vlad 2007-08-11 03:22:58 +00:00
pavlov%pavlov.net 5bed14625c make bitmap fonts support their space character. bug 386389. r=vlad 2007-08-10 20:00:03 +00:00
roc+%cs.cmu.edu 67cb988c94 Bug 391068. Fix ATSUI cluster analysis loop. r=vlad,a=pavlov 2007-08-10 02:24:38 +00:00
roc+%cs.cmu.edu 9feffdc761 Bug 385719. Allow text substrings passed to gfxTextRun APIs to start or end in the middle of a cluster. r+a=pavlov 2007-08-10 01:35:32 +00:00
vladimir%pobox.com e3bb5d1251 b=390668, crash in gfxASurface::GetType (_moz_cairo_scaled_font_status and others), often using drawWindow 2007-08-09 18:54:19 +00:00
vladimir%pobox.com cc87109165 b=383512, make (win32) gfx support text drawing onto any surface type, r/a=stuart 2007-08-07 22:46:42 +00:00
vladimir%pobox.com ef7d71801f b=390912, odd black bars with stroked rounded rects outside of view bounds, r=shaver, rs=k&r (checking back in, linux failure seemed transient yay) 2007-08-07 03:56:16 +00:00
vladimir%pobox.com d6dcbc0f08 backing out 390912, not sure what's wrong with linux 2007-08-07 01:52:15 +00:00
vladimir%pobox.com d4337a1652 b=367036, the bug that won't die, forgot to reapply this patch when I upgraded cairo (background of images shows as black when printed) 2007-08-07 01:15:56 +00:00
vladimir%pobox.com a9b5dc170e b=390912, odd black bars with stroked rounded rects outside of view bounds, r=shaver, rs=k&r 2007-08-07 01:14:47 +00:00
benjamin%smedbergs.us a311b83259 Bug 387132 followup - build the reftest-fast tool correctly with libxul, r=vlad a=only functional change is NPOB 2007-08-06 20:13:19 +00:00
sdwilsh%shawnwilsher.com 4129c776bc Bug 355789 - Use vista native uxtheme for menu rendering. Patch by Rob Arnold <robarnold@mozilla.com>. r=vladimir, a=[wanted-1.9] 2007-08-06 17:45:58 +00:00
mats.palmgren%bredband.net 18b4ec129e Bail out of gfxFont::Draw if setting up the Cairo font fails. b=390476 r+sr=pavlov a19=pavlov 2007-08-06 12:30:15 +00:00
vladimir%pobox.com b9f73ed056 b=390798, animated gifs shrunk to favicon size; also b=390622, yahoo mail beta misrendered; r=stuart 2007-08-06 04:14:14 +00:00
sharparrow1%yahoo.com af6e9bc4e1 Bug 389938 - Full page zoom does not affect text with CSS font set to message-box. r+sr=roc, a=pavlov 2007-08-03 23:39:37 +00:00
sharparrow1%yahoo.com 87c5423b19 Bug 390039: antialiasing incosistent when using full page zoom. r=vlad, a=pavlov 2007-08-03 23:37:17 +00:00
masayuki%d-toybox.com 747a29fe1a The additional patch for bug 364786 r=vlad 2007-08-03 18:37:50 +00:00
mozilla%weilbacher.org 630c726edf [OS/2] Bug 390077: OS/2 build break after integration of lcms (work around OS/2 typedef), p=wuno, r=pavlov 2007-08-03 15:37:27 +00:00
ginn.chen%sun.com d797e70e54 Bug 390113 mozilla should not be compiled with -fast on Solaris
r=benjamin
2007-08-03 06:32:33 +00:00
ginn.chen%sun.com 3fbe87da95 Bug 390749 Fix build on Solaris
r+a=vladimir
2007-08-03 06:29:31 +00:00
sharparrow1%yahoo.com 742d572526 Bug 389459: lines appear when scrolling page while image loading at >144 dpi. r=vlad, a19=dbaron 2007-08-02 21:03:30 +00:00
vladimir%pobox.com a5444f09c6 avoid divide-by-zero in allocating 0x0 surface 2007-08-02 13:04:39 +00:00
vladimir%pobox.com ba90e9dcec avoid divide-by-zero resulting from push_group 2007-08-02 12:48:30 +00:00
vladimir%pobox.com 510301e12a linux tinderbox fix, thought I fixed this a different way, guess not 2007-08-02 07:11:27 +00:00
vladimir%pobox.com af8b80660d b=383960, moz cairo: win32/msvc fixes, disable MMX util it's fixed 2007-08-02 07:02:41 +00:00
vladimir%pobox.com 3671298a99 b=383960, moz cairo: new cairo-rename.h 2007-08-02 07:02:18 +00:00
vladimir%pobox.com 354481f07f b=383960, moz cairo: fix up compilation with in-tree pixman 2007-08-02 07:01:57 +00:00
vladimir%pobox.com 85a917cc75 b=383960, moz cairo: nonfatal-assertions.patch 2007-08-02 07:01:36 +00:00
vladimir%pobox.com ca262e81bf b=383960, moz cairo: win32-no-printer-bitblt.patch 2007-08-02 07:01:14 +00:00
vladimir%pobox.com e8fc935e79 b=383960, moz cairo: win32-logical-font-scale.patch 2007-08-02 07:00:53 +00:00
vladimir%pobox.com 64b7559394 b=383960, moz cairo: win32-scaled-font-size.patch 2007-08-02 07:00:33 +00:00
vladimir%pobox.com 9b0fa32962 b=383960, moz cairo: no longer needed: quartz-glyph-rounding.patch 2007-08-02 07:00:10 +00:00
vladimir%pobox.com c19846f601 b=383960, moz cairo: no longer needed: fbcompose-bandaid.patch 2007-08-02 06:59:49 +00:00
vladimir%pobox.com 5c6f7a7894 b=383960, moz cairo: max-font-size.patch 2007-08-02 06:59:30 +00:00
vladimir%pobox.com d29822a8da b=383960, Cairo 1.5.x: fix XLIB_XRENDER feature 2007-08-02 06:59:07 +00:00
vladimir%pobox.com 0aed64fdc4 b=383960, Cairo 1.5.x: Cairo 2007-08-02 06:58:47 +00:00
vladimir%pobox.com ffe60d5197 b=383960, Cairo 1.5.x: pixman mozilla fixes 2007-08-02 06:57:51 +00:00
vladimir%pobox.com ff8604e4b1 b=383960, Cairo 1.5.x: pixman 2007-08-02 06:54:41 +00:00
vladimir%pobox.com 80d6a3239f b=390202, trunk topcrash gfxFont::Draw, r=stuart,a=damon 2007-07-31 20:34:43 +00:00
sharparrow1%yahoo.com 3bcee5da48 Update UUID after checkin for bug 4821 2007-07-26 20:28:00 +00:00
roc+%cs.cmu.edu e034b1023e Trivial fix that should fix Linux reftests 2007-07-26 11:22:57 +00:00
roc+%cs.cmu.edu 8477256fc6 Bug 387969. Use CSS 'text-rendering' property to control text quality. r=pavlov,r+sr=bzbarsky 2007-07-26 09:47:45 +00:00
sharparrow1%yahoo.com 6ddd341252 Bug 4821: Implement page zoom (backend). r+sr=roc. 2007-07-26 03:34:16 +00:00
vladimir%pobox.com af44235d8f b=339553, drawString enhancement for canvas, r=me; patch from robarnold 2007-07-25 18:21:35 +00:00
sharparrow1%yahoo.com b1cd4b4e4d Bug 376124: Some rounding fixes related to a scrolling paint bug. r=vlad 2007-07-25 17:19:40 +00:00
vladimir%pobox.com 73de954433 cairo backout 2007-07-24 19:26:01 +00:00
vladimir%pobox.com ae59053b45 backing out cairo update, again 2007-07-24 19:24:28 +00:00
vladimir%pobox.com a25d89e03a b=383960, moz cairo: new cairo-rename.h 2007-07-24 17:46:07 +00:00
vladimir%pobox.com b658fb4723 b=383960, moz cairo: MSVC compilation fixes 2007-07-24 17:45:51 +00:00
vladimir%pobox.com 3ec680ace4 b=383960, moz cairo: fix up compilation with in-tree pixman 2007-07-24 17:43:30 +00:00
vladimir%pobox.com 78dd8bf03e b=383960, moz cairo: nonfatal-assertions.patch 2007-07-24 17:43:11 +00:00
vladimir%pobox.com 8b88917a3b b=383960, moz cairo: win32-no-printer-bitblt.patch 2007-07-24 17:38:48 +00:00
vladimir%pobox.com 7e3a3b0fa2 b=383960, moz cairo: win32-logical-font-scale.patch 2007-07-24 17:38:30 +00:00
vladimir%pobox.com 9aa412990c b=383960, moz cairo: win32-scaled-font-size.patch 2007-07-24 17:38:12 +00:00
vladimir%pobox.com 04c57a5fb2 b=383960, moz cairo: no longer needed: quartz-glyph-rounding.patch 2007-07-24 17:36:53 +00:00
vladimir%pobox.com e7205941a2 b=383960, moz cairo: no longer needed: fbcompose-bandaid.patch 2007-07-24 17:36:36 +00:00
vladimir%pobox.com 82def42ea2 b=383960, moz cairo: max-font-size.patch 2007-07-24 17:36:18 +00:00
vladimir%pobox.com 3edc57bad1 b=383960, Cairo 1.5.x: fix XLIB_XRENDER feature 2007-07-24 17:33:27 +00:00
vladimir%pobox.com 2bb1fde041 b=383960, Cairo 1.5.x: Cairo 2007-07-24 17:29:35 +00:00
vladimir%pobox.com 77ffdbcc05 b=383960, Cairo 1.5.x: pixman mozilla fixes 2007-07-24 17:11:07 +00:00
vladimir%pobox.com 65dc770de8 b=383960, Cairo 1.5.x: pixman 2007-07-24 17:08:21 +00:00
jwalden%mit.edu 641f7e64d8 --enable-tests bustage fix, after color management landing. r=sparky 2007-07-24 01:06:07 +00:00
pavlov%pavlov.net 041108163b adding color management capabilities -- preffed off. bug 16769. patch from tor. r=bsmedberg, sr=me 2007-07-23 22:02:20 +00:00
longsonr%gmail.com 7c247a907f Bug 388385 - Memory leak with SVG patterns and clipPaths. r+sr=vladimir 2007-07-23 08:54:52 +00:00
ted.mielczarek%gmail.com 28e29bc0ec fix thunderbird bustage from bug 388663 2007-07-19 15:21:13 +00:00
pavlov%pavlov.net c74198dad9 export thebes symbols from libxul. bug 388663. r=vlad 2007-07-19 00:13:14 +00:00
benjamin%smedbergs.us 0c2f7fc337 Bug 388542 - --disable-libxul broken in thebes (in some circumstances), r=vlad 2007-07-18 15:52:41 +00:00
vladimir%pobox.com 70d4f6641f b=364300, monospace font sometimes isn't with ATSUI, breaking cols attribute of textarea, r+sr=roc 2007-07-18 14:41:40 +00:00
vladimir%pobox.com c3913871bc b=364786, improve Mac font selection, r=masayuki,sr=roc 2007-07-18 14:22:07 +00:00
vladimir%pobox.com 59bcd9c96a b=386895, speed up gfx text rendering (microbenchmark), r=roc 2007-07-17 23:13:48 +00:00
vladimir%pobox.com f6d6e8b5d6 b=386897, compile cairo/pixman with full speed optimization, r=roc,sr=stuart 2007-07-17 23:08:32 +00:00
dbaron%dbaron.org 9c3cfde5da Move the code needed to get language group-specific font enumeration working and remove the rest of nsFontConfigUtils. b=379888 r=vlad 2007-07-17 21:58:46 +00:00
roc+%cs.cmu.edu ef59b67ebe Adding comment. 2007-07-16 23:45:16 +00:00
roc+%cs.cmu.edu ca33eb1043 Fixing reftest failure, hopefully. r=pavlov 2007-07-16 23:44:41 +00:00
roc+%cs.cmu.edu 1a61a026d8 Bug 386920. Preserve line-break data when copying glyphs. r=pavlov 2007-07-16 22:50:35 +00:00
roc+%cs.cmu.edu 8ad768a282 Bug 387703. Make all-8bit Unicode text take the Xft fast path if that's enabled, to ensure it's displayed consistently. r=pavlov 2007-07-16 22:49:11 +00:00
smontagu%smontagu.org ed669580fb Process glyphs in right-to-left clusters in reverse order. Bug 387653, r=vlad 2007-07-16 06:18:08 +00:00
kherron%fmailbox.com 5699bd57b9 Bug 337771 - Native -moz-appearance work for menus and toolbars on Windows XP. Patch by Simon B�nzli <zeniko@gmail.com>. r=emaijala, sr=bzbarsky. 2007-07-14 15:11:38 +00:00
roc+%cs.cmu.edu 57913dde6c Bug 387867. Rename DISABLE_LIGATURES to DISABLE_OPTIONAL_LIGATURES and make the ATSUI code only disable optional ligatures. r=pavlov 2007-07-13 08:09:28 +00:00
pavlov%pavlov.net 01e3955d34 speed up setting of code points. bug 386375. r=vlad 2007-07-12 18:14:59 +00:00
pavlov%pavlov.net f8138088bb re-enabling kerning on the mac. bug 387197. r=vlad 2007-07-11 17:41:26 +00:00
benjamin%smedbergs.us d83c776371 Bug 386445 - mac build stops with "multiple definitions of symbol nsINIParser::GetSrings", also changes to building mac dylibs with -single_module, r=luser,jag 2007-07-11 17:26:12 +00:00
ginn.chen%sun.com 8c4c28d7e4 Bug 387399 Asian fonts are not rendered in web page on BIG ENDIAN machine
r=vladimir
2007-07-11 06:40:39 +00:00
sharparrow1%yahoo.com b329ef5c40 Bug 382595: Lines across embedded svg when scrolling. Followup rounding fix. r+sr=roc 2007-07-09 05:04:02 +00:00
jwalden%mit.edu ef68fcf595 Bug 348748 - Replace all instances of NS_STATIC_CAST and friends with C++ casts (and simultaneously bitrot nearly every patch in existence). r=bsmedberg on the script that did this. Tune in next time for Macro Wars: Episode II: Attack on the LL_* Macros. 2007-07-08 07:08:56 +00:00
smontagu%smontagu.org 1c02d29d91 Add an mIsRTL flag to the textrun word cache hash key. Bug 386339, r+sr=roc 2007-07-06 05:52:56 +00:00
mozilla%weilbacher.org 251c180c95 [OS/2] Fix build break in gfxOS2Fonts.cpp (mimic gfxPangoFonts change that supposedly came from Bug 385423) 2007-07-05 20:50:44 +00:00
mats.palmgren%bredband.net 42661ee1ed Remove non-cairo PostScript support. b=385577 r=kherron sr=pavlov 2007-07-05 11:29:53 +00:00
roc+%cs.cmu.edu 2a49badb09 Bug 385423. Force ZWSP, PSEP and LSEP to be treated as zero-width invisible and not passed into platform textrun creation. Avoids potential bugs and forces consistent handling. r=vlad 2007-07-05 03:07:25 +00:00
roc+%cs.cmu.edu 69671fd285 Bug 386804. Make 'cache not empty' assertion into a warning. r=vlad 2007-07-05 03:05:06 +00:00
vladimir%pobox.com 0860c79031 b=361695, [mac] bidi mirroring proken with some fonts, r=vladimir, patch from jdaggett@mozilla.com 2007-07-04 09:19:27 +00:00
roc+%cs.cmu.edu cbb0f270bd Fixing bustage 2007-07-04 04:07:01 +00:00